Module: AGG Basics

Start: 22.05.2025 End: 23.05.2025

The German Anti-Discrimination Association (advd) invites you to the project “Community-based counseling” to the module “AGG Basics” .
The following content will be covered:

  • Legal context on discrimination – international and national
  • Introduction to the General Equal Treatment Act (AGG) – Contents, benefits, exercises for classifying cases, deadlines
  • Differentiation from legal services – When does advice become a legal service, and under what conditions are advisors allowed to offer it?

Target group:
The module is aimed at prospective independent consultants working in civil society counseling centers – preferably with a focus on racism and anti-racism.

Note:
This module is one of the compulsory modules as part of the Joint Certificate in Community-Based Anti-Racism Counseling (2023–2025)Therefore, consultantsinside the project partnersinside have priority in the selection.
